Core Viewpoint - The AI sector is experiencing a significant surge, with domestic AI chip leader Cambricon surpassing Kweichow Moutai in stock price, indicating a shift in investor sentiment towards AI over traditional sectors like liquor [1][5]. Group 1: AI Industry Dynamics - The current A-share market is characterized as a structural bull market, driven by asset revaluation rather than broad-based growth [3][4]. - The AI industry is seen as the new frontier for value discovery, moving away from traditional sectors like liquor and new energy vehicles [5][6]. - The U.S. has been aggressively pursuing an "America First" AI hegemony strategy, aiming to maintain its technological leadership and geopolitical influence [8][9][10][12]. Group 2: Domestic AI Breakthrough - Cambricon's stock price surge reflects the initial success of China's domestic AI breakthrough against U.S. dominance [7][15]. - The U.S. has set two major "choke points" in advanced chips and core algorithms, which, if overcome, could lead to a revaluation of domestic AI companies like Cambricon [16][17]. - Domestic AI firms are adapting by innovating in software to better utilize local hardware, as exemplified by DeepSeek's new model designed for upcoming domestic chips [18][20]. Group 3: Market Opportunities and Challenges - The shift towards domestic AI solutions is gaining momentum, with major Chinese companies increasingly looking to local suppliers due to security concerns over U.S. chips [35]. - Cambricon's financial situation is improving, with a significant increase in revenue and a reduction in losses, indicating a potential turnaround [29][37]. - Despite impressive growth figures, Cambricon's high valuation raises concerns about potential market bubbles, as its dynamic P/E ratio remains exceedingly high [40][42]. Group 4: Future Outlook - The narrative surrounding Cambricon as a potential replacement for Nvidia is compelling, but the competitive landscape suggests that it may not dominate the market alone [50][51]. - The ongoing development of an open-source ecosystem in China is challenging the closed-source models of U.S. firms, indicating a shift in the competitive dynamics of the AI sector [22][24][26].
